DESCRIPTION:Rémi Rhodes: The study of second-order phase transitions in tw
 o-dimensional statistical physics models led\, in the 1980s\, to the emerg
 ence of conformal field theories (CFT). The development of the conformal b
 ootstrap in physics brought remarkable advances in the understanding and s
 olution of these theories. However\, a rigorous mathematical construction 
 of CFTs and a complete implementation of the bootstrap program remain majo
 r open challenges.\nOver the past twenty years\, the probabilistic approac
 h to a specific CFT\, the Liouville theory\, has achieved important progre
 ss. It has not only provided a mathematical construction of the model and 
 a full bootstrap solution\, but also made explicit the various structural 
 components expected of a field theory and their interplay: path integral f
 ormulation\, Segal functoriality\, state–field correspondence\, represen
 tation of the symmetry algebra on a Hilbert space\, and the Operator Produ
 ct Expansion (OPE).\nLiouville theory thus stands as a genuine case study 
 for understanding the mathematical structure of conformal field theories.\
 nThe aim of this talk is to show how these concepts are organized and inte
 ract within the framework of Liouville theory.
